What happens when a subscription ends?
If your Genio Notes/Present subscription ends, or you remove a user's access to Genio then the account goes through multiple stages before it is ultimately deleted.
We refer to these stages as 'offboarding'.
This ensures that your users have time to access notes they have created in Genio Notes/Present after expiry.
Good to know - the offboarding stages are identical whether an individual user account expires or when an entire organisation subscription ends.
Offboarding Stages
When a subscription ends, or an account reaches its expiry date, it progresses through two distinct offboarding stages: Deactivated / Deleted.
The first phase of the 'Deactivated' stage starts immediately after your subscription ends or an account reaches expiry.

* At the end of the first 90-day 'Deactivated' stage, accounts are 'locked'. The 'Deactivated' stage lasts for a minimum of 12 months, i.e. until 12 months after your subscription expiry date.
** 12 months after your subscription ends, accounts are marked for deletion. Accounts and any account data and user content may be deleted after 12 months, and will be deleted no later than 18 months after expiration.
Offboarding Notifications
Users will see offboarding notifications displayed within Genio Notes/Present throughout the first 90 days of the 'Deactivated' stage.
We will also attempt to contact users by email to notify them of changes to their access at each stage.
Users will be able to request a download of their content (i.e. notes they have created in Genio Notes/Present) prior to permanent deletion.
